David E. Lemon, DDS, FAGD

DDS: University of Illinois at Chicago College of Dentistry, Chicago, IL
Fellow: Academy of General Dentistry
Dental Officer: United States Navy Dental Corps, Fleet Marine Force, 1975-1977
BS: Dentistry, University of Illinois, Chicago, IL
Member: American Academy of Cosmetic Dentistry, American Dental Association, Illinois State Dental Society, Chicago Dental Society, Rock Island District Dental Society

David E. Lemon, DDS, FAGD

“I enjoy working with my hands. As a kid, I would spend hours working with and customizing model kits. As a teenager, I built my own stereo receiver. I enjoyed science and wanted to pursue a career in healthcare. Dentistry seemed to be a good fit for blending my enjoyment of science and working with my hands.

“You need good problem-solving skills in dentistry. I find it very satisfying to help my patients achieve good oral health, even if they have had problems in the past. What I enjoy most, though, is meeting and developing relationships with the people who see me for care.

“I’m a hometown kid! I was raised in Moline, where my father was a teacher at the high school. I graduated from Moline High School in 1968 and then pursued my education in dentistry. I subsequently joined the Navy as a dental officer, after which it only seemed natural that I return to Moline and open my own office in 1980.

“By learning about and from the many people I meet, I create a bond that allows for better discussion about their dental concerns. This way, I can better serve and provide for their needs and wants.”

Joseph D. Jackson, DMD

DMD: Southern Illinois University School of Dental Medicine, Alton, IL
BS: Biology,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Champaign, IL
Volunteer: Christina’s Smile, a children’s dental clinic that travels with the PGA Tour to provide free dental care to children in need
Member: American Academy of Cosmetic Dentistry, Academy of General Dentistry, American Dental Association, Illinois State Dental Society, Rock Island District Dental Society
